Analysis
In 2014, ghana — plywood — import quantity in Belgium stood at 181 m3.
That represents a change of down 36.5% on the previous year and down 98.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, ghana — plywood — import quantity in Belgium peaked at 12,333 m3 in 2003 and was at its lowest, 89 m3, in 2012.
That places Belgium 7th out of 35 countries with data for 2014, putting it in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 6,959 m3 | 777 m3 | 12,333 m3 | 10 |
| 2010s | 282 m3 | 89 m3 | 484 m3 | 5 |
